VNX array triggers an alert with Symptom Code a09 which indicates the drives are replaced. Alert: Device Bus 2 Enclosure 4 Disk 24 SoftwareRev 7.33.2 (0.51) BaseRev 05.32.000.5.249 : CRU Drive too Small Log Instances: 2.4.24 005049925PWR 6XS44CZ2 CS19 CS20 Upgrade to firmware revision CS20 or later if drive S/N is listed in FCO CAL. ------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- MLU TPID ALU FLU RGRP ENCTYPE TYPE PRIV LD CAPACITY CACHE DEFOWN STATE NAVIFRUS ------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- - - 15876 63 220 SAS HotSpare Y - 820.2 GB --- SP-B ENA 2.4.24 - - 15876 63 220 SAS HotSpare Y - 820.2 GB --- SP-B ENA 2.4.24 2.4.24 220 900GB SAS SEAGATE Compass 6XS44CZ2 118033046 005049925PWR CS19 HS Ready Inactive 6 6
This alert triggers when drive replacement is performed Onsite.
Perform the heath check for the VNX Array. Check the status of the drive using the below command: naviseccli getdisk x_y_z; Where x denotes bus,y denotes Enclosure,z denotes Drive. If multiple soft media errors or time-out errors have been reported on the mentioned drive, then replace the affected drive. If Health Check of the array is clean, the drive have not logged any media errors, Soft Media/SCSI Errors, and the array is operating normally. No action is required. Recommendation:As per FCO, recommend performing the drive Firmware Upgrade. 2.4.24 005049925PWR 6XS44CZ2 CS19 CS20Upgrade to firmware revision CS20 or later if drive S/N is listed in FCO CAL
